Sijhwa village is located in the Bhabua Subdivision of the Kaimur district in the Bihar.

Sijhwa has a total population of 806 people, out of which the male population is 416 while the female population is 390. The literacy rate of Sijhwa village is 47.52%, out of which 60.10% males and 34.10% females are literate. There are about 152 houses in Sijhwa village.
